2. EXAMINE WARRANTY AND CERTIFICATION

Warranties and certifications are not mere formalities; they serve as important indicators of a solar tube’s authenticity. Genuine manufacturers typically offer substantial warranties, reflecting their confidence in the durability and efficiency of their products. Most warranties cover parts and performance over a specific timeframe, often ranging from 10 to 25 years. A short or limited warranty may raise concerns regarding the product’s quality, suggesting that the manufacturer does not fully stand behind its claims.

In addition to warranties, certifications from reputable organizations provide assurance of a product’s compliance with industry standards. Common certifications include those from the International Organization for Standardization (ISO) or the Solar Rating and Certification Corporation (SRCC). These entities verify the efficiency and safety of solar products, thereby adding an extra layer of credibility. Taking the time to meticulously scrutinize warranty details and certifications can ultimately safeguard consumers against inferior products masquerading as genuine solar tubes.

3. INSPECT MATERIALS USED

The materials utilized in the construction of solar tubes greatly influence their efficiency and life span. When assessing authenticity, it is crucial to consider aspects such as the quality of glass, the type of reflective coating, and the insulation properties of the tubes. Authentic solar tubes are usually made from high-quality, tempered glass capable of withstanding various environmental conditions while maintaining optimal thermal efficiency. Conversely, tubes made from substandard materials may not only perform poorly but may also pose safety risks.

Additionally, the reflective coating inside solar tubes plays a pivotal role in enhancing energy collection. A genuine solar tube will often have a highly efficient coating, such as aluminum or silver, which maximizes reflection while minimizing heat loss. Furthermore, the insulation surrounding the tube’s cavity can also significantly impact its performance; high-quality thermal insulation will help maintain the collected heat, ensuring the maximum utility of the solar system. By examining the materials used in solar tubes, potential buyers can discern genuine products from those that may lack durability or efficiency.

FAQ 3: CAN SOLAR TUBES BE INSTALLED IN ANY ROOF TYPE?

Solar tubes offer remarkable versatility, allowing them to be installed on various roof types, including shingles, tiles, and metal roofs. The adaptability of solar tube systems makes them suitable for numerous architectural designs and styles. Installation may require specific adjustments to accommodate particular roofing materials, but experienced installers typically find ways to ensure a secure fit without compromising the roof’s integrity.

However, several factors can influence the feasibility of installation, including roof slope and local building codes. Depending on these conditions, additional flashing or supports may be required to properly integrate the solar tubes into the existing structure. As a rule of thumb, consulting with professional installers can provide clarity regarding installation suitability based on individual circumstances.
